Creating Comprehensive and Effective Measurement Instruments: Part One
Presenters: ABA Legal Center for Foster Care and Education Attorneys
Date: February 16, 2023
Time: 10:00 a.m. to 11:30 a.m.
Description: The Legal Center for Foster Care and Education will present a two-part webinar and workshop on creating comprehensive and effect measurement instruments and surveys to assess program efficacy and gather qualitative feedback.
This webinar will include:
An overview of the importance of monitoring program efficacy through the development and implementation pre and post intervention surveys and tools.
A walkthrough of a comprehensive measurement building tool (“Evaluating the Impact of Education Interventions for California’s Students in Foster Care: A Menu of Measures” by Sophia Gatowski, Ph.D., Consultant, American Bar Association Center on Children and the Law).
A preview of sample tools and resources for difference types of interventions and audiences.

Differentiated Assistance and LCAP Development: Tools for Supporting Students in Foster Care
Presenters: Dr. Heather Richter, Administrator and Curt Williams, Director Kern County Supt. of Schools
Date: March 9, 2023
Time: 1:30 p.m. to 3:00 p.m.
Description: This webinar will provide an overview of the Differentiated Assistance and the Local Control Accountability Plan processes in Kern County with an emphasis on youth experiencing foster care. Discussion will involve how these tools can be used by FYSCPs to help LEAs support students experiencing foster care. Kern’s FYSCP staff will also discuss initiatives such as the Dream Center for Foster Youth, Youth Empowering Success (YES!), and Youth Voice and Youth Advisory Boards as strategies LEAs can use as LCAP goals and assessment tools. Intro to Trauma-Informed Practices in Schools (Part 1)
Presenter: Kim Faulkner-Camacho, LACOE TAP
Date: February 8, 2023
Time: 10:00 a.m. to 12:00 p.m.
Description: This training will provide participants with an understanding of trauma, its prevalence and impact on students and families, and what it means to be trauma-informed. Participants will learn about strategies for working with students affected by trauma and how to apply those strategies in a school setting. It will contain specific examples of how it impacts students in foster care and students experiencing homelessness but will provide valuable and practical tips for all students dealing with childhood trauma.

Trauma-Informed Practices for Schools Training of Trainers (In-Person)
Presenters: Kim Faulkner-Camacho & Mindy Corless, LACOE/TAP
Drew Shwartz, 123 Wellness
Location: Monterey COE
Date: April 13-14, 2023
Time: 8: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m. (second day ends at 4:00 pm)
Description: This in-person training will provide a basic understanding of how trauma impacts student learning, the impact of trauma on the brain, an understanding of Adverse Childhood Experiences, strategies and tips for helping students impacted by trauma, and Self-care and wellness tips for adults, and a facilitator’s guide and training materials.
